Moin Moin,
kann es sein, daß PWM/PWMR nicht mit ConfigDB zusammenläuft?
Ich habe reproduzierbar nach jedem "update" gefolgt von "shutdown restart" das Problem, daß alle PWRs nicht mehr arbeiten. Die Aktoren sind im unknown-State und verbleiben in dem Schaltzustand vor dem restart Befehl, die Zimmer werden kalt - oder sehr warm.
Lösung ist, in jedem PWMR auf das "DEF"-Icon zu klicken und die Definition unverändert abzuspeichern. Danach geht der Raum auf Initialized und fängt an zu arbeiten.
Im Anhang die PWM/PMR heute Morgen sowie ein List eines PWMRs, sowie ein List nach dem Neuabspeichern der unveränderten DEF.
Nicht arbeitender PWMR:
Internals:
ACTOR S_FussbodenLennart
DEF PWM.FussbodenHeizung 1,0 HM_OG.LENNART_Wandthermostat_Climate:measured-temp S_FussbodenLennart dummy 1:0.8:0.3,5:0.5,10
FUUID 5c5aa285-f33f-4ba1-72c2-699dc09be67020d4
FVERSION 93_PWMR.pm:0.210300/2020-01-21
INTERVAL 300
IODev
NAME PW_RoomLennart
NR 338
STATE From HM_OG.LENNART_Wandthermostat_Climate
TEMPSENSOR HM_OG.LENNART_Wandthermostat_Climate:measured-temp
TYPE PWMR
WINDOW
a_regexp_on on
actor S_FussbodenLennart
c_PID_DFactor 0.5
c_PID_DLookBackCnt 10
c_PID_IFactor 0.3
c_PID_ILookBackCnt 5
c_PID_PFactor 0.8
c_PID_useit 1
c_autoCalcTemp 1
c_desiredTempFrom HM_OG.LENNART_Wandthermostat_Climate:desired-temp
c_frostProtect 0
c_tempC 22
c_tempD 20
c_tempE 19
c_tempFrostProtect 6
c_tempN 16
c_tempRule1 1-5 0600,D 2200,N
c_tempRule2 6-0 0800,D 2200,N
c_tempRule3
c_tempRule4
c_tempRule5
c_tempRuleS D
d_name HM_OG.LENNART_Wandthermostat_Climate
d_reading desired-temp
d_regexpTemp (\d[\d\.]+)
h_deltaTemp 0
h_deltaTemp_D 0
p_actor S_FussbodenLennart
p_factor 1,0
p_pid 1:0.8:0.3,5:0.5,10
p_tsensor HM_OG.LENNART_Wandthermostat_Climate:measured-temp
p_window dummy
t_reading measured-temp
t_regexp ([\d\.]+)
t_sensor HM_OG.LENNART_Wandthermostat_Climate
w_regexp .*[Oo]pen.*
windows dummy
READINGS:
2020-02-03 09:26:02 PID_DVal 0.00
2020-02-03 09:26:02 PID_IVal -0.15
2020-02-03 09:26:02 PID_PVal 0.00
2020-02-03 09:26:02 PID_PWMOnTime 00:00
2020-02-03 09:26:02 PID_PWMPulse 0
2020-02-03 09:27:01 actorState unknown
2020-02-04 07:10:54 desired-temp 21.0
2019-09-26 18:45:58 desired-temp-until no
2020-02-03 09:26:02 desired-temp-used 20.0
2020-02-03 09:26:02 energyused 000000000000000000000000000000
2020-02-03 09:26:02 energyusedp 0.0
2020-02-03 08:39:01 lastswitch 1580715541.85429
2019-04-13 07:57:42 manualTempDuration 0
2020-02-03 09:26:02 oldpulse 0.0001
2020-02-04 07:10:54 state From HM_OG.LENNART_Wandthermostat_Climate
2020-02-03 09:26:02 temperature 20.1
helper:
PID_D_previousTemps:
PID_I_previousTemps:
Attributes:
desiredTempFrom HM_OG.LENNART_Wandthermostat_Climate:desired-temp
frostProtect 0
room R_HWR
Nach Neuabspeichern der Definition:
Internals:
ACTOR S_FussbodenLennart
DEF PWM.FussbodenHeizung 1,0 HM_OG.LENNART_Wandthermostat_Climate:measured-temp S_FussbodenLennart dummy 1:0.8:0.3,5:0.5,10
FUUID 5c5aa285-f33f-4ba1-72c2-699dc09be67020d4
FVERSION 93_PWMR.pm:0.210300/2020-01-21
INTERVAL 300
IODev PWM.FussbodenHeizung
NAME PW_RoomLennart
NR 338
STATE From HM_OG.LENNART_Wandthermostat_Climate
TEMPSENSOR HM_OG.LENNART_Wandthermostat_Climate:measured-temp
TYPE PWMR
WINDOW
a_regexp_on on
actor S_FussbodenLennart
c_PID_DFactor 0.5
c_PID_DLookBackCnt 10
c_PID_IFactor 0.3
c_PID_ILookBackCnt 5
c_PID_PFactor 0.8
c_PID_useit 1
c_autoCalcTemp 1
c_desiredTempFrom HM_OG.LENNART_Wandthermostat_Climate:desired-temp
c_frostProtect 0
c_tempC 22
c_tempD 20
c_tempE 19
c_tempFrostProtect 6
c_tempN 16
c_tempRule1 1-5 0600,D 2200,N
c_tempRule2 6-0 0800,D 2200,N
c_tempRule3
c_tempRule4
c_tempRule5
c_tempRuleS D
d_name HM_OG.LENNART_Wandthermostat_Climate
d_reading desired-temp
d_regexpTemp (\d[\d\.]+)
h_deltaTemp -3.0
h_deltaTemp_D -3.0
p_actor S_FussbodenLennart
p_factor 1,0
p_pid 1:0.8:0.3,5:0.5,10
p_tsensor HM_OG.LENNART_Wandthermostat_Climate:measured-temp
p_window dummy
t_reading measured-temp
t_regexp ([\d\.]+)
t_sensor HM_OG.LENNART_Wandthermostat_Climate
w_regexp .*[Oo]pen.*
windows dummy
READINGS:
2020-02-04 07:16:57 PID_DVal 0.00
2020-02-04 07:16:57 PID_IVal 1
2020-02-04 07:16:57 PID_PVal 1
2020-02-04 07:16:57 PID_PWMOnTime 15:00
2020-02-04 07:16:57 PID_PWMPulse 100
2020-02-04 07:15:57 actorState on
2020-02-04 07:15:54 desired-temp 21.0
2019-09-26 18:45:58 desired-temp-until no
2020-02-04 07:16:57 desired-temp-used 21.0
2020-02-04 07:16:57 energyused 000000000000000000000000000011
2020-02-04 07:16:57 energyusedp 6.7
2020-02-04 07:15:57 lastswitch 1580796957.69834
2019-04-13 07:57:42 manualTempDuration 0
2020-02-04 07:16:57 oldpulse 1
2020-02-04 07:15:54 state From HM_OG.LENNART_Wandthermostat_Climate
2020-02-04 07:16:57 temperature 18.0
helper:
PID_D_previousTemps:
18.0
18.0
PID_I_previousTemps:
18.0
18.0
Attributes:
desiredTempFrom HM_OG.LENNART_Wandthermostat_Climate:desired-temp
frostProtect 0
room R_HWR
Danke, -MN